Lucknow hospital rapes patient, arrests director and doctor


Published: 04:57 23 May 2026
Police have arrested the hospital director and a doctor in connection with the rape of a woman undergoing treatment at a private hospital in Lucknow, India. Local law enforcement confirmed the matter on Saturday (May 23).
According to police sources, the woman was admitted to a hospital in Lucknow's Bakshi Ka Talab area on May 19 for treatment. It is alleged that an untoward incident occurred inside the operation theater on May 21 during treatment. Later, the police started an investigation after the victim's family filed a written complaint.
Based on the complaint, a case was filed under the relevant sections of the Indian law. The hospital director and a doctor in charge were questioned during the investigation. After reviewing the initial information and evidence, the police took them into custody.
Authorities said that various evidence related to the incident has been collected as part of the investigation. Later, when the accused were produced in court, they were ordered to be sent to judicial custody.
Police said the investigation into the incident is ongoing and necessary legal action will be taken after verifying the detailed information.
